Millard West Basketball
Standout Courtney Janecek Signs with Bobcats
(Peru, NE)
PSC Head Coach Maurtice Ivy has announced that
Millard West standout Courtney Janecek has signed an
NAIA Letter of Intent to play basketball for the
Bobcats. Janecek was a member of three straight
District Championship teams at Millard West with the
2007-08 squad finishing as State Class A Runners-up.
MW was a state semi-finalist in 2005-06.
The 6'0" Janecek averaged 6.3 ppg and 1.6 apg this
past season while shooting 52% from the field in
being named All-Metro and All-State Honorable
Mention. Janecek is #1 all-time at Millard West in
free throw shooting percentage (77.2%) and this past
season led the state of Nebraska while shooting
85.7% from the charity stripe.
"Courtney is a solid post player that is a hard
worker defensively and has nice touch around the
basket," said Ivy. She has a wonderful attitude
about the game and is going to be a great addition
to our team."
